WHAT COULD HAPPEN
Published: 4/10/2009 | Updated: 4/18/2009

If Bud Niekamp resigns from the Quincy School Board, the remaining board members would have 45 days to choose a replacement.

If they could not, Regional Superintendent of Schools Ray Scheiter be given 30 days to choose.

If Niekamp steps down from the County Board, that board would name a replacement.
